The Stargate Modification is a scripted add-on for Operation Flashpoint, ArmA and ArmA II,
it has been unofficially created as a way for fans to explore the Stargate as it is portrayed in the shows.
This add-on is completely unofficial and though we have gone through great lengths to mimic functions as shown in the shows
it is down to our own interpretation and may not be true to what SCI FI Channel or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er Studios Inc intended.
